A Solicitor provides legal advice to clients, drafts and reviews contracts, handles property transactions, and represents clients in legal proceedings. This role requires deep legal knowledge, client management skills, and attention to detail. Resumes should demonstrate transaction volume, case outcomes, and client impact.

Common mistakes to avoid
- Describing practice areas without showing transaction complexity, case outcomes, or client impact.
- Using a generic summary that does not name the target role.
- Listing tools without showing where they were used.
- Adding metrics that are not supported by project, work, or portfolio evidence.
